They’re at it again: lecturers call second day of strikes

It’s another day off for students as staff walk out over pay.


Feckless lecturers are booking in a day of Christmas shopping for December 3 as they call a second day of strike action.

Having already gone on strike over pay once this term (not just blocking us from lectures, but using the library bathrooms too!) uni staff are set to walk out next month if the current “pay row is not resolved”.

Lecturers’ trade union, the University and College Union (UCU), has called the strike, and will be joined by union heavyweights Unison, Unite, and EIS, Scotland’s largest teaching union.
